Debra Kay Bell, 66, passed away on December 28, 2024 at Ascension St. Vincent’s Riverside. She was born on October 3, 1958 in Jacksonville, Florida. She graduated from the University of North Florida with a degree in Elementary Education/Instructional Technology. For 36 years it was her joy teaching at elementary schools throughout Duval County, most recently at John Stockton Elementary. She was a kind and giving person with a love for life. She was a loving mother and doting grandmother. Her surviving family includes her two sons Scott Bell and Ryan (Lucia) Bell; two grandchildren Giselle and Phoebe; brother Doug (Jennifer) Steel; sister Sheri (Glenn Beck) Steel; and several nieces and nephews. The family will receive friends for a visitation on Saturday, January 11th at Fraser Funeral Home, 8168 Normandy Blvd. Jacksonville, FL 32221 from 3pm to 5pm.
